【KEPServerEX Datalogger数据分析】:解读日志信息的专家指南
发布时间: 2024-12-19 04:36:28 阅读量: 5 订阅数: 4
KEPServerEX之Datalogger操作文档
5星 · 资源好评率100%
![【KEPServerEX Datalogger数据分析】:解读日志信息的专家指南](https://www.industryemea.com/storage/Press Files/2873/2873-KEP001_MarketingIllustration.jpg)
# 摘要
KEPServerEX Datalogger 是一种广泛使用的工业级数据采集和日志记录软件,具有强大的数据收集、分析和应用功能。本文从基础的数据连接配置与管理,数据采集策略和日志信息的结构与格式讲起,逐步深入到数据分析的理论基础、方法论以及实时数据分析的重要性。文章还探讨了KEPServerEX Datalogger 在实战应用中的日志数据可视化展示、故障诊断与性能优化,以及日志数据的安全分析。最后,本文展望了KEPServerEX Datalogger 在物联网与大数据背景下的应用前景和未来发展趋势,强调了高级数据分析技术在未来工业自动化和IT监控中的关键作用。通过案例研究,本文揭示了KEPServerEX Datalogger 在实际应用中的高效性和可靠性,以及其在不断进化的技术环境中的潜力。
# 关键字
KEPServerEX Datalogger;数据采集;日志分析;数据分析;实时监控;物联网;大数据技术
参考资源链接:[KEPServerEX之Datalogger操作文档](https://wenku.csdn.net/doc/6412b74fbe7fbd1778d49d59?spm=1055.2635.3001.10343)
# 1. KEPServerEX Datalogger 概述
在自动化和工业信息技术领域,KEPServerEX Datalogger 成为了连接底层设备与企业信息系统的桥梁。它不仅仅是一个简单的数据记录器,而是一个完整的数据集成平台,可以高效地从多种来源采集、处理、记录和管理数据。本章我们将简要介绍KEPServerEX Datalogger的核心价值以及它在工业自动化中的应用背景。
KEPServerEX Datalogger通过提供高效的通信、强大的数据处理能力和丰富的数据格式支持,让企业能够更好地利用设备生成的数据,进而提升生产效率、减少停机时间并提高产品质量。它支持广泛的通信协议,兼容多种设备和系统,为企业提供了一个可扩展的、可靠的解决方案。
接下来的章节会深入探讨KEPServerEX Datalogger的数据收集基础,数据分析理论,实战应用案例,以及未来的发展趋势和高级技巧,为IT和工业自动化专业人士提供实用的知识和技能。
# 2. KEPServerEX Datalogger 数据收集基础
KEPServerEX Datalogger 是一种工业级的数据采集与日志记录解决方案,它能够从各种数据源收集数据并将其记录在日志文件中,便于后续的数据分析和处理。在本章节中,我们将深入探讨如何配置和管理数据源连接,以及如何根据需要调整数据采集策略。此外,本章还会介绍高级数据过滤和解析技术,这对于从海量数据中提取有价值信息至关重要。
## 2.1 数据连接配置与管理
数据连接是整个数据收集过程的起点,良好的连接配置是保证数据流动畅通无阻的基础。KEPServerEX Datalogger 支持多种数据源,包括各类PLC、SCADA系统和企业应用等。
### 2.1.1 配置数据源连接
配置数据源连接涉及到设定数据采集的起点,即指定要连接的数据源类型和相关参数。对于大多数工业应用来说,数据源可能是现场的传感器、控制器或者某个特定的工业设备。
**示例:配置一个OPC UA数据源连接**
1. 打开KEPServerEX Datalogger软件。
2. 在“配置”菜单下选择“数据源”。
3. 点击“添加”按钮,选择“OPC UA”数据源类型。
4. 在弹出的配置对话框中填写服务器地址、端口和安全设置。
5. 点击“测试连接”确保配置正确,连接成功后点击“确定”保存。
#### 连接属性详解
- **服务器地址**:OPC UA服务器的网络地址,通常是IP地址加端口号。
- **端口**:OPC UA服务监听的端口,默认是4840。
- **安全设置**:包括认证方式、安全策略和加密方法,确保数据交换的安全性。
### 2.1.2 管理数据源和连接属性
一旦建立了数据源连接,下一步就是对这些连接进行管理和调整。对于运行中的KEPServerEX Datalogger,管理员可以在“运行模式”下实时监控和修改连接属性。
**操作步骤**
1. 在KEPServerEX主界面,点击“运行模式”。
2. 在“数据源”标签页,列出所有已配置的数据源连接。
3. 选中需要修改的连接,点击“编辑”按钮。
4. 在弹出的属性窗口中,可以调整连接参数和超时设置等。
#### 连接属性调整
- **超时设置**:控制读取操作的超时时间,防止因为网络延时等原因造成连接挂起。
- **死区和报警**:设置读取值变化的最小幅度,以及报警阈值,用于过滤噪声数据。
## 2.2 数据采集策略与日志信息
数据采集策略定义了数据收集的频率、触发方式和日志记录的结构。
### 2.2.1 采集频率与触发方式
为了不影响生产系统性能,合理的采集频率至关重要。KEPServerEX Datalogger 支持定时采集和事件驱动采集两种方式。
**定时采集**
- 通过设定时间间隔来周期性地读取数据。
- 适用于数据变化不频繁,对实时性要求不高的场景。
**事件驱动采集**
- 当数据源发生特定事件时才触发数据采集。
- 适用于需要实时响应的场景,比如异常状态报警。
### 2.2.2 日志信息的结构和格式
日志信息的结构和格式关系到数据的后续处理和分析。KEPServerEX Datalogger允许用户自定义日志文件的格式,以满足不同需求。
**日志格式自定义**
- 可以设定日志文件的字段,包括时间戳、数据源标识、数据值和质量标记等。
- 支持多种日志格式,如CSV、JSON和自定义格式。
## 2.3 高级数据过滤与解析
高级数据过滤和解析使得KEPServerEX Datalogger能够处理更复杂的数据场景,确保记录的信息质量。
### 2.3.1 设置数据过滤规则
数据过滤规则用于筛选出符合特定条件的数据,从而减少无用数据记录,提高日志分析效率。
**示例:设置温度数据过滤规则**
假设我们要记录所有超过35°C的温度数据,我们可以在数据源配置中添加如下规则:
```python
# Python代码示例,实际应用中需要在KEPServerEX配置界面中设置
if temperature > 35:
log_event(temperature)
```
#### 过滤规则的设置
- **条件表达式**:根据实际需求设置数据筛选条件,如数值范围、状态标识等。
- **动作**:根据条件表达式的真假执行不同的记录动作。
### 2.3.2 日志解析器的配置和优化
解析器用于将原始数据转换成结构化的日志信息。KEPServerEX Datalogger允许用户配置或创建自定义解析器,以适应不同的数据格式。
**示例:自定义解析器配置**
假设我们有一个自定义的数据格式,包含时间戳、设备ID和传感器读数。我们需要创建一个解析器来处理这种格式:
```python
# Python代码示例,实际应用中需要在KEPServerEX配置界面中设置
def custom_parser(raw_data):
timestamp, device_id, sensor_value = parse_raw_data(raw_data)
return {
'timestamp': timestamp,
'device_id': device_id,
'sensor_value': sensor_value
}
```
#### 解析器的配置和优化
- **解析表达式**:定义如何从原始数据中提取信息。
- **性能优化**:优化解析器的性能,减少CPU和内存消耗。
通过本章节的介绍,我们了解到KEPServerEX Datalogger在数据收集方面的核心功能和优势。在后续章节中,我们将深入探讨如何对这些收集来的数据进行分析和
0
0